WebMar 3, 2024 · Veterinary nurses are healthcare professionals who assist veterinarians with providing medical treatment for animals. They work in vet offices with doctors of veterinary medicine and other veterinary staff, including technicians and administrative assistants. WebMay 2, 2016 · A first step: NAVTA recently announced their effort to establish a nationally standardized credentialing requirement for veterinary technicians and a title change to veterinary nurse. As the association explores these changes, it's pertinent to look further ahead and think of a possibility of a nurse practitioner-like role in veterinary medicine.
